Polystyrene beads are the most common type of bean bag filling and are widely available in the UK These small, lightweight beads are made from expanded polystyrene and provide a firm yet flexible support for the body Polystyrene beads are durable and can withstand regular use, making them a great choice for bean bags that will be used frequently However, some people find that polystyrene beads can compress over time, leading to a loss of support and comfort To combat this issue, some manufacturers offer top-up packs of beads that can be used to refill bean bags as needed.

Another popular option for bean bag filling in the UK is memory foam Memory foam is a viscoelastic material that conforms to the shape of the body, providing a customised and comfortable seating experience Bean bags filled with memory foam are often more expensive than those filled with polystyrene beads, but many people find the additional cost to be worth it for the superior comfort and support that memory foam provides Memory foam bean bags are also less likely to compress over time, making them a long-lasting and dependable choice.

Shredded foam is made from small pieces of foam that are compressed together to create a supportive and comfortable filling for bean bags Bean bags filled with shredded foam have a more solid feel than those filled with polystyrene beads, making them a great choice for people who prefer a firmer seating option Shredded foam bean bags are also more eco-friendly than those filled with polystyrene beads, as foam can be recycled and reused.

Microfibre is a luxurious and soft bean bag filling option that is perfect for those who prefer a more plush seating experience Microfibre filling is made from tiny microfibres that are soft to the touch and provide a cloud-like feeling when sitting on a bean bag Bean bags filled with microfibre are incredibly comfortable and can be used for hours on end without causing any discomfort However, microfibre bean bags are typically more expensive than those filled with other materials, so they may not be the best choice for those on a budget.

When choosing bean bag filling in the UK, it is important to consider your own preferences and needs If you prefer a firmer seating option, polystyrene beads or shredded foam may be the best choice for you If you want a more luxurious and soft seating experience, memory foam or microfibre may be the better option Ultimately, the best bean bag filling for you will depend on your own comfort preferences and budget.
